Hi.
I want to make the switch from Windows to Linux, but I have a lot of programs that are written with Windows in mind (e.g. MathCAD 2000, MS Office 2000).

If I use WinE, or some other Windows Emulator, will the programs for Windows run under Linux with the same speed and stability? And are there types of programs that will not run under Linux using WinE?

Thanks. I am trying to weigh the costs and benefits of switching to Linux. Any advice is greatly appreciated. Also, I am not that fond of using a dual-boot configuration or LiLo to load a partitioned Windows.

the wine web page has a list of programs its supported and users rate the programs. most of the microsoft stuff has 5's. if youre worried about a specific program not being supported you might want to try vmware which emulates the whole windows platform so you should be able to run anything. im not sure about the stability or speed of vmware tho.

Using an emulator to use Windows software is a losing battle. You're bound to run into quirks under an emulated environment which might never crop up in a full Wintel package.

Many folks will try to tell you that their software became "more stable" when they switched to the emulator, but what they're not telling you is that many features and functions cease to work properly. And you will never receive any sort of support for software if it's running through an emulator.

IMHO, if you use Windows software heavily, stick with Windows. The operating system's job should be a transparent way of getting applications to the user. If you want to run MS Office, then stick with Windows. If you want to switch to Linux applications, then great, switch to Linux.

But if you're committed to your Windows apps, and you don't have time to learn some of the nitty-gritty details of a Unix operating system, it's not worth the switch.
